In plastics processing, geometry, wall thickness and dimensional accuracy determine part quality and process stability. Whether it be extrusion, injection molding or thermoforming, every product must be inspected reliably directly in the running process. 3D laser profile sensors from AT Sensors deliver precise profile and geometry data and create the basis for automated, reproducible inline quality control.
Industrial plastics processing is characterized by high throughput rates, complex tooling and sensitive process parameters. Even small deviations in profile, wall thickness or part geometry can lead to functional issues, increased scrap or costly rework. At the same time, requirements are rising for continuous process monitoring and seamless quality control directly in production.
3D laser profile sensors from AT Sensors provide contactless inspection of profiles, contours and height information immediately after forming. Sensor solutions from AT Sensors capture geometry data independent of surface condition or gloss level, making them ideal for demanding plastics processes.
Typical applications in the plastics industry include profile and wall thickness measurement in extrusion processes, geometry inspection of injection molded parts, contour control of thermoformed components, and monitoring of dimensional accuracy and warpage directly after the tool. Even with changing materials and process conditions, the sensors deliver stable, reproducible measurement results.
The result is continuous quality control that reduces scrap, stabilizes processes and ensures consistently high part quality over the entire production period.
